Pakola is a line of flavored carbonated soft drinks originating from Pakistan, the product name is derived from "Pakistan Cola".How ever do not confuse it with Pakula

Origin

Pakola was launched in Pakistan on 14 August 1950, by Haji Ali Muhammad. The Pakola brand name is owned by Teli family. In 2007, the Teli family sold its rights to the Leghari family. Today the Leghari family who previously owned Sukkur Pepsi, own the rights to Pakola nation wide with the exception of Karachi city.

Products

Although the green drink, "Pakola Cream Soda", became the company's trademark product, several variants have since been introduced, namely, Pakola Lychee, Pakola Orange, Pakola Raspberry, and Pakola Fresh Lime. Pakola has also launched a milk range produced by Pakola Products Limited.

Production

Pakola is currently produced by two companies, Mehran Bottlers and Gul Bottlers.

Distribution

Pakola is one of the few beverages manufactured in Pakistan that is exported globally.
